Mohamed Lamine Selmane
Lamine is the regional Energy expert leading the Global Energy practice at Dell Technologies for Middle East and Africa region.
He joined EMC in 2014, before the merge with Dell in 2016. He is responsible for the development and deployment of digital solutions and services that drive business outcomes for the entire energy value chain
Thorough his 20 years career in the oil and gas and utilities industries, he has been working on the fields of Data management, Smart Fields, Grid Automation, OT Cybersecurity, Industrial IoT, AI and Cloud
As part of this job, Lamine has been developing an industry eco-system of partnerships with engineering software vendors, OT suppliers and System Integrators to identify and develop innovative joint digital solutions. He’s also contributing to Dell’s efforts to actively participate in industry consortia such as Open Group, Linux Foundation…
Lamine is directly involved in Dell’s efforts to help the industry execute its Energy Transition with impactful deployment of IT and digitalization across the entire value chain, and along a pathway to a low carbon future. He has also interest in Green Sovereign Data Centers
Prior to Dell – Lamine accumulated 8 years of experience with Schlumberger (now SLB), delivering oil and gas upstream information solutions for national and independent oil companies in North Africa region. He was also involved in transformational engagements in areas of business intelligence and knowledge management.
Lamine has Computer Science Engineering degree from the National Institute of Computer Science in his home country Algeria
